Machinability of damage-tolerant titanium alloy in orthogonal turn-milling

Tao SUN, Lufang QIN, Junming HOU, Yucan FU

《机械工程前沿(英文)》 2020年 第15卷 第3期   页码 504-515 doi: 10.1007/s11465-020-0586-2

摘要: The damage-tolerant titanium alloy TC21 is used extensively in important parts of advanced aircraft because of its high strength and durability. However, cutting TC21 entails problems, such as high cutting temperature, high tool tip stress, rapid tool wear, and difficulty guaranteeing processing quality. Orthogonal turn-milling can be used to solve these problems. In this study, the machinability of TC21 in orthogonal turn-milling is investigated experimentally to optimize the cutting parameters of orthogonal turn-milling and improve the machining efficiency, tool life, and machining quality of TC21. The mechanism of the effect of turn-milling parameters on tool life is discussed, the relationship between each parameter and tool life is analyzed, and the failure process of a TiAlN-coated tool in turn-milling is explored. Experiments are conducted on the integrity of the machined surface (surface roughness, metallographic structure, and work hardening) by turn-milling, and how the parameters influence such integrity is analyzed. Then, reasonable cutting parameters for TC21 in orthogonal turn-milling are recommended. This study provides strong guidance for exploring the machinability of difficult-to-cut-materials in orthogonal turn-milling and improves the applicability of orthogonal turn-milling for such materials.

A review of low-temperature plasma-assisted machining: from mechanism to application

《机械工程前沿(英文)》 2023年 第18卷 第1期 doi: 10.1007/s11465-022-0734-y

摘要: Materials with high hardness, strength or plasticity have been widely used in the fields of aviation, aerospace, and military, among others. However, the poor machinability of these materials leads to large cutting forces, high cutting temperatures, serious tool wear, and chip adhesion, which affect machining quality. Low-temperature plasma contains a variety of active particles and can effectively adjust material properties, including hardness, strength, ductility, and wettability, significantly improving material machinability. In this paper, we first discuss the mechanisms and applications of low-temperature plasma-assisted machining. After introducing the characteristics, classifications, and action mechanisms of the low-temperature plasma, we describe the effects of the low-temperature plasma on different machining processes of various difficult-to-cut materials. The low-temperature plasma can be classified as hot plasma and cold plasma according to the different equilibrium states. Hot plasma improves material machinability via the thermal softening effect induced by the high temperature, whereas the main mechanisms of the cold plasma can be summarized as chemical reactions to reduce material hardness, the hydrophilization effect to improve surface wettability, and the Rehbinder effect to promote fracture. In addition, hybrid machining methods combining the merits of the low-temperature plasma and other energy fields like ultrasonic vibration, liquid nitrogen, and minimum quantity lubrication are also described and analyzed. Finally, the promising development trends of low-temperature plasma-assisted machining are presented, which include more precise control of the heat-affected zone in hot plasma-assisted machining, cold plasma-assisted polishing of metal materials, and further investigations on the reaction mechanisms between the cold plasma and other materials.

Machinability of ultrasonic vibration-assisted micro-grinding in biological bone using nanolubricant

《机械工程前沿(英文)》 2023年 第18卷 第1期 doi: 10.1007/s11465-022-0717-z

摘要: Bone grinding is an essential and vital procedure in most surgical operations. Currently, the insufficient cooling capacity of dry grinding, poor visibility of drip irrigation surgery area, and large grinding force leading to high grinding temperature are the technical bottlenecks of micro-grinding. A new micro-grinding process called ultrasonic vibration-assisted nanoparticle jet mist cooling (U-NJMC) is innovatively proposed to solve the technical problem. It combines the advantages of ultrasonic vibration (UV) and nanoparticle jet mist cooling (NJMC). Notwithstanding, the combined effect of multi parameter collaborative of U-NJMC on cooling has not been investigated. The grinding force, friction coefficient, specific grinding energy, and grinding temperature under dry, drip irrigation, UV, minimum quantity lubrication (MQL), NJMC, and U-NJMC micro-grinding were compared and analyzed. Results showed that the minimum normal grinding force and tangential grinding force of U-NJMC micro-grinding were 1.39 and 0.32 N, which were 75.1% and 82.9% less than those in dry grinding, respectively. The minimum friction coefficient and specific grinding energy were achieved using U-NJMC. Compared with dry, drip, UV, MQL, and NJMC grinding, the friction coefficient of U-NJMC was decreased by 31.3%, 17.0%, 19.0%, 9.8%, and 12.5%, respectively, and the specific grinding energy was decreased by 83.0%, 72.7%, 77.8%, 52.3%, and 64.7%, respectively. Compared with UV or NJMC alone, the grinding temperature of U-NJMC was decreased by 33.5% and 10.0%, respectively. These results showed that U-NJMC provides a novel approach for clinical surgical micro-grinding of biological bone.
